Yes, it's a cold old day but we loved to sing and a
little snow just isn't going to slow us down. (smile) So, I would
like to welcome you now to listen to the old Allegre Quartet. These next
few songs were on an old practice tape we did at the church way back in
1982. I wish that the quality was better because these are some great old
songs. Brother Arvil Harrison found this tape and was kind enough to let
me copy from it. The quartet consist of; Carol Troutman, (lead), Arvil
Harrison, (Baritone), Bro. C. B. Troutman, (tenor), Jim Keeling, (Bass),
and Joyce Strader, (Piano) I hope that you will enjoy listening as I
present to you;

The Allegre Quartet.
